The Hollywood actor has wiped £1 million worth of debt for people in south Wales, using £100,000 of his own money to set up a debt acquisition company. His mission? To help 900 people escape the burden of financial hardship.
Sheen’s generosity and determination are highlighted in Michael Sheen’s Secret Million Pound Giveaway, a new Channel 4 documentary airing next Monday, which exposes how banks and finance companies profit from society’s most vulnerable.
This isn’t the first time Sheen has put his money where his heart is. He previously sold his houses to ensure the 2019 Homeless World Cup went ahead in Cardiff and recently pledged to fund a new theatre company in Wales. In 2021, he even declared himself a “not-for-profit” actor, vowing to use his earnings for good causes.
The debt-buying system is complex, but Sheen saw an opportunity to turn it on its head. Instead of companies profiting from people’s struggles, he found a way to buy up debt at a lower cost and write it off completely. The process took two years to complete in secret, and Sheen still doesn’t know the identities of the people he has helped—only that their lives will be a little easier.
